Tech

SR Frontend Developer (Angular)

Cairo
Work Type: Full Time

Responsibilities:

  • Develop new user-facing features.
  • Build reusable code and libraries for future use.
  • Ensure the technical feasibility of UI/UX designs.
  • Optimize application for maximum speed and scalability.
  • Assure that all user input is validated before submitting to back-end.
  • Collaborate with other team members and stakeholders.
  • Proficiency in, Bootstrap, ngx, Angular Material, and SASS, LESS.
  • Experience Responsive web design methodologies.
  • Excellent Javascript knowledge and extensive experience with ES5/ES6.
  • Extensive experience with Typescript.
  • Solid understanding with RXJS.
  • A solid understanding of state management concepts, with a previous experience in NGRX, or NGXS is a plus.
  • Extensive experience with tools like Redux, Webpack, Angular CLI.
  • Extensive experience consuming REST APIs and working with observables.
  • Extensive experience with client-side architecture and design patterns.
  • Exceptional knowledge of cross-browser compatibility issues and client-side performance considerations.
  • Extensive experience with Git.
  • Document all codes of the development processes to record and facilitate the work of other developers
  • Provide detailed estimates of work and ensure timely delivery of features.
  • Adhere to an agile process, striving to deliver new value regularly to our users.

Job Requirements:

  • Bachelor's Degree in Computer Science, Computer Engineering or any relevant discipline.
  • Proficient understanding of web markup.
  • 5-6 years working experience in frontend web development (with angular).
  • Exceptional learning skills.
  • Exceptional problem solving and ability to work independently.

Bonus points:


  • E-commerce working experience


Submit Your Application

You have successfully applied
  • You have errors in applying

Work Experience